3Summary Analysis

On paper, Austin, TX pays $16,000 more (median: $96,000 vs $112,000). However, after adjusting for cost of living (index 123 vs 124), Austin, TX provides better purchasing power ($78,049 vs $90,323 equivalent). Miami, FL has no state income tax, which is a significant advantage.
